Abstract
We have been investigating and developing several interactive environments for learning by problem-posing targeting arithmetical word problems. In this paper, we describe "triplet structure" of an arithmetical word problem that is composed of two "single quantity sentences" and one "relative quantity sentence", as the base model of the design of these learning environments. We also report practice use of the interactive learning environments in usual class room by using tablet PCs.
